    And, meanwhile, you can use Pop-up Menu in many situations where you've been using autocompletion in columns:
    Select the column, and format the cells in the column as Pop-Up Menu:
    If you've selected the whole column before formatting as Pop-up, your existing values in that column will pre-populate a menu automatically:
    Then you remove the values you don't want in the list, such as the column header (and possibly some previous spelling errors too!):
    And after this easy one-time setup all you have to do thereafter is to choose from the pop-up list when you add rows:
    There's no keyboard shortcut to activate the menu such as they had in the old Numbers (hope they'll add one). But the Pop-Up Menu approach has some advantages over autocompletion: no spelling errors or lack of capitalization when there should be capitalization, etc. 
    And should you ever want to take your Numbers with you, in a touch interface pop-ups are much more efficient than typing the first few letters of items.

  • E65 Predictive Text Error - You insists on being Y...

    Well, my first post, E65 predictive texting does not recognise You or YOU or you ! it insists on Yot ! Any quick fix out there for this problem?
    Thanks
    skthecat

    Yes.
    T9 works a little different from earlier S60 implementations. It used to be that when you added a word with the 'Spell' function, that it went in as the last choice.
    Now it goes in as the first choice. So if you add a word by mistake, OR if you add a word that starts with 'yot' then that's the first choice that comes up.
    So it's important these days to think twice before adding a word.
    Fortunately it also 'learns' which words are used more often. The quickest fix is to type the word 'you' several times in an SMS message or in a text note.
    So you type 'you' (yot will appear), then press the asterrisk until 'you' appears. Put in a space and do it again. and again. And again; it varies how many times you have to do this, last time it happened to me I had to type & correct about 5-6 times or so I think.
    There's other ways as well, such as removing the dictionary file with a third party file manager such as 'Y-Browser'. But then you lose all the other words you added as well. Google how that is done works.

  • Predictive text non-English characters to be made ...

    I just filled an enhancement request on this feature, please vote for it HERE:
    Predictive text non-English characters to be made optional
    The story is: while using predictive text for non-English languages (Polish in my case) the dictionary words are grammar correct which include special characters like: ą,ę,ć,ś,ż,ź,ó,ł etc. For texting (SMS) operators count these as 3 characters making a message much longer than it looks. Therefore I can tell you no one uses these characters while texting and people use EN only characters instead a,e,c,s,z,o,l... which makes using the predictive text useless for eg Polish language.
    I'd like to have an option to switch using these non-en chars off for predicting text, which is grammatically not correct but in real life that's how people type.
    So basically if there's an option to disable lang specific characters I would be getting an example suggestion of 'Prosze' instead of grammatically correct 'Proszę'. 'Prosze' is a 6 character word, 'Proszę' is a 5+3=8 character word. Considering a single SMS message a 300 chars, than it really makes a difference.
    Simple solution would be to replace every char ą with a, ć with c, ó with o etc... in each word suggested for the ones who have this option enabled.
